Hallofreakinween Closeout
Anyone else get turned away at the door for Hallofreakin'ween in Denver?
I found a brief explanation on the Triad Dragons website saying that the original venue didn't have the parking lot finished in time so it was a last minute thing to hold it at the Palladium. Now, the question I have is this: did they sell walk-in tickets and, if so, they knew it was a smaller venue, why did they sell walk-up tickets beyond what had been pre-paid?
I was very, VERY disappointed by the handling of this - I was turned away at midnight from the show - I can't imagine how many more people showed up and had the same treatment. I know they have stated they will be issuing refunds to those who did not get in with pre-pays but I have no idea how they will do this so I won't hold my breath.
In the end, I will think very little of attending another one of these big shows - Skylab offered redemption in the form of a much better venue and I was hoping they would continue that. "Parking lot not finished" is no excuse to me - for an event this large, get your shit straight from the get-go - especially that many months in advance and with a lineup like that. Usually, I am very forgiving with my reviews of parties but is just ridiculous.
